I have registered sql loader control file as a concurrent program within APPS.
I now want it to find the datafile I am trying to load which is on the unix server.
How do I specify the path to the datafile in APPS.
I also want the control file to load all the datafiles that are within that same folder on the Unix server if there is more than one file. All the files are of the same format.
